diff -r 5315654608de -r 08c6ee43b396 idlehomescreen/xmluirendering/uiengine/src/xnwidgetextensionadapter.cpp --- a/idlehomescreen/xmluirendering/uiengine/src/xnwidgetextensionadapter.cpp Thu Jan 07 12:39:41 2010 +0200 +++ b/idlehomescreen/xmluirendering/uiengine/src/xnwidgetextensionadapter.cpp Mon Jan 18 20:10:36 2010 +0200 @@ -266,10 +266,10 @@ // we can close it if ( aPointerEvent.iType == TPointerEvent::EButton1Down ) { - CXnDomStringPool& sp = + CXnDomStringPool* sp = iNode.Node().DomNode()->StringPool(); CXnProperty* prop = CXnProperty::NewL( KDisplay, KNone, - CXnDomPropertyValue::EString, sp ); + CXnDomPropertyValue::EString, *sp ); CleanupStack::PushL( prop ); iNode.Node().SetPropertyL( prop ); CleanupStack::Pop( prop );